Skateboard culture seen by those who live it. Born as a simple pastime, skateboarding has become a real culture in the early 70s. Since then, it has never stopped evolving, bringing in every decade a wave of innovations and creations capable of influencing many aspects of our society: fashion, photography, music, cinema, design... With 17 interviews with key figures of skateboard culture (including Wes Humpston, Marc McKee and Spike Jonze), 250 skaters, 400 photographs, 65 advertisements, 100 stickers, 180 boards and countless tricks, this volume illustrates all the key events of a rebellious DNA culture. A comprehensive work from a historical and technical point of view, for professionals and enthusiasts, encouraging you to launch into flips, grinds, and tailslides.
